Former Big Brother Naija housemates Bella Okagbue and Sheggz have reportedly taken their relationship drama to the legal stage. Reports claim Bella’s lawyers have served Sheggz a pre-action notice over an alleged breach of promise to marry. The notice reportedly includes claims of domestic abuse.
The legal team is also said to be demanding repayment of money allegedly borrowed by Sheggz during their relationship. According to the report, the amount exceeds £10,000 and ₦19 million.
Bella and Sheggz became one of BBNaija’s most talked-about couples after meeting on the reality show. Their relationship continued after the show and attracted plenty of attention from fans online.
However, their romance later ended, with both parties moving on with their lives. Now, the reported legal notice has brought their past relationship back into the spotlight.
